The music of A.J. Leonard is original and at the same time tantalizingly familiar, reinventing elements of romance and nostalgia. It is ukulele music for the 21st century.
The album is made up of songs and instrumentals with influences ranging from The Beach Boys (Away From It All and Meet Me In Hawaii), The Shadows (Big Island), traditional Hawaiian music (Makawao), shades of the Orient (The Sound of Rain) and contemporary trance (The Road To Hana)
A.J.’s connection with the tropics began at an early age when he sailed to Hawaii with his family on the way to the USA. (On The Mariposa) He still remembers the giant harbor side pineapple sign and the welcome leis courtesy of the beautiful Hawaiian women.
In 2006 A.J. visited Hawaii for the fourth time to purchase a new ukulele and whilst there sowed the seeds for what was to become his greatest album to date, Tales From the Tropics.
